Everton have reportedly made a bid worth €25 million for Jean-Clair Todibo, who could be on his way out of Barcelona this summer.

According to a report by Spanish publication SPORT, Jean-Clair Todibo is expected to be the first player to leave Barcelona in the summer transfer window. The La Liga champions have received an offer worth €25 million for the 20-year-old defender from Everton, who are in the market for a centre-back.

Todibo joined Barcelona from Toulouse in January 2019, costing the Blaugrana just €2 million. The Frenchman was eased into the thick of action by then-manager Ernesto Valverde and he made just a couple of appearances in the second half of last season.

A similar pattern ensued at the start of this season, with Gerard Pique, Clement Lenglet and Samuel Umtiti ahead of him in the pecking order. As a result, Todibo turned out just twice for Barcelona before he was loaned out to Schalke in January. The player has made a decent start at Schalke, with 8 appearances under his belt already.

The 20-year-old defender was even named Schalke’s Player of the Month for March. The German outfit have been left impressed by the Barcelona loanee, but are unlikely to take up the €25 million purchase option after being hit hard financially by the coronavirus pandemic. However, Barcelona still have suitors lining up for Todibo, with Everton leading the chasing pack.

Everton are reportedly in the market for a centre-back, especially amid speculation surrounding the future of Mason Holgate, who has been linked with Manchester City. In case Holgate leaves, the Toffees will need to sign a replacement, considering Carlo Ancelotti will be left with just Yerry Mina and Michael Keane as his only recognised central defensive options.

Jonjoe Kenny is expected to return to Goodison Park for good when his loan spell at Schalke, where he is teammates with Barcelona loanee Todibo, ends. However, Ancelotti will need another centre-back to complete his options. As a result, Everton have been linked with a number of central defenders.

Reports had suggested that they were taking big steps to sign Gabriel Magalhaes. That ship, though, seems to have sailed, with Todibo now on Everton’s radar. That the Merseyside club share good relations with Barcelona ought to keep them in good stead in their pursuit of the 20-year-old defender.

The report claims that Everton are matching Barcelona’s valuation of the French youngster and are ready to make an offer totaling to €25 million. Barcelona are, in turn, hoping to use the funds procured from Todibo’s sale to fund the move for Lautaro Martinez, their priority target.

What now remains to be seen is if Todibo becomes the latest Barcelona player to make his way to Everton. The Toffees seem to be willing to pay the €25 million asking price, meaning a move to Goodison Park could be in the offing.
